Law allows Delaware museums to establish title to property that has been donated or left with them after a loan period has terminated and the lender could not be found.

Quilt collection of the State of Delaware Following are photographs of some of the more than 100 quilts that are curated by the Division of Historical and Cultural Affairs (HCA) as part of the collections of the State of Delaware.
